686 FNUS75 KSLC 240251 FWSSLC Spot Forecast for Narrows SAR...Zion National Park National Weather Service Salt Lake City UT 851 PM MDT Sun Jun 23 2024 Forecast is based on forecast start time of 2200 MDT on June 23. If conditions become unrepresentative...contact the National Weather Service. .DISCUSSION...Updating spot forecast provide the latest on the disorganized area of showers and thunderstorms. They remain situated south of the park and mostly impacting areas along the Utah/Arizona border with an overall loss in strength noted. There is much less confidence that these showers will impact the park through the evening. Winds are expected to be light and generally out of the southwest before decreasing further overnight. It is possible outflow winds from the showers/storms approach from the south which could reach the Narrows. .REST OF TONIGHT/OVERNIGHT... Sky/weather.........Clearing Chance of pcpn......Less than 20 percent. Min temperature.....57-59. Max humidity........80-82 percent. Surface winds (mph).Southwest winds 3 to 6 mph becoming variable after midnight at less than 5 mph. Potential for outflow winds this evening. .MONDAY... Sky/weather.........Mostly sunny (10-20 percent cloud cover). Chance of pcpn......20 percent in the afternoon. Max temperature.....91-93. Min humidity........18-20 percent.
